    Depends what you mean by 'detail' it. Are you meaning adding parts such as pipelines etc or painting and weathering? Either way, you need good reference pictures that show the area that you want to work on. Pipes like hydraulics can be added using thin wire, copper wire stripped from cable works but I refer lead wire as it is softer and shapes very easily. Depending on the scale, you can add cable clamps by painting tin strips of masking tape the colour you want and wrapping that around the pipe and the undercarriage leg.

    Lots of existing detail can be brought out by pin washing, running very thinned down black paint around edges of raised detail and in hollows, this will create a shadow effect that will enhance the detail.
